    I hope you are kidding because Atlanta is a very, very talented athletically. Have you seen Josh Smith, Josh Childress, or Marvin Williams jump? The make the floor look like a trampoline. And add Joe Johnson and Al Horford to that squad and they have plenty of talent. Their biggest problem is they don't have a solid inside game (like most of the league).

    As a team, we are very talented because we play team defense and that carries us vary far, but individual talent-wise, we are on the lower end of the scale in these playoffs because with Yao out and the rest of your starters banged-up, we are forced to play guys out of position and that hurts us. Without a doubt, we are the least talented of the West and in the east, maybe Toronto and Philly have less talent than us, but everyone else is much more talented.

    Josh Smith, Al Hortford, Joe Johnson, Mike Bibby.

    2 of those guys were Allstar players, Josh Smith is 2nd in the league in blocks, and Al Hortford is probably going to win rookie of the year.

    In terms of pure talent, probably only the 76er's have less.

    But you also need to remember our entire team is built around 2 guys, Yao and TMAC, so without one other teams could easily exploit our lack of firepower because everyone else around them are role players, not play makers.
